"Your Excellency, the Third Young Master wants to invest in the construction of steel mills, arsenals, and shipyards, as well as railways. This will undoubtedly greatly promote the development of Westernization."
Once these steel mills, arsenals, and shipyards are completed, they will greatly enhance our strength.
However, there are probably significant risks involved.
The imperial court won't just stand by and watch us build so many factories.
Especially since the Third Young Master wants to build these factories on the Liaodong Peninsula, which involves Anshan, the jurisdiction of the Shengjing General!
Zhou Fu had a serious expression; he was Li Hongzhang's most trusted advisor.
Li Hongzhang nodded; he understood this as well.
After Prince Gong Yixin lost power, the Westernization Movement suffered a severe blow.
Even Li Hongzhang faced considerable criticism and suppression from the die-hards.
If Li Hongzhang hadn't held considerable military power, controlling the Huai Army, the Beiyang Army, and the Beiyang Fleet, he might have already been eliminated.
"Father, I have a suggestion," Li Jingfang said.
"Tell me about it?" Li Hongzhang asked.
"Father, those diehards and nobles in the court are arrogant and domineering. But they are afraid of foreigners."
We can have our third brother invest under the name of a foreign company.
He even suggested that his third brother hire foreigners to manage the business.
When facing foreigners, even those die-hards and nobles probably wouldn't dare to act recklessly!
Li Jingfang said.
Li Hongzhang's eyes lit up.
He knew very well that those guys in the imperial court were all bullies who preyed on the weak and feared the strong.
But when faced with foreigners, they were all terrified and couldn't even stand up straight.
If Li Hongzhang's son wanted to build a factory on the Liaodong Peninsula, he would definitely face all sorts of difficulties.
But if it's a foreigner, then it's probably a different story.

"Alright, let's do it that way! Send a telegram to the third brother, he should know what to do!" Li Hongzhang instructed.
"Yes, Father, I will personally send a telegram to my third brother!" Li Jingfang replied.
"In addition, we still need to make some concessions. General Yulu of Shengjing is also a man who loves money. Send him some silver and he'll just ignore it!" Li Hongzhang continued.
"Yes, Your Excellency!" Zhou Fu and Sheng Xuanhuai both replied.
"Gentlemen, this matter must be kept strictly confidential. Absolutely no word of it must be leaked. Otherwise, if the court finds out the truth, we will all be punished!" Li Hongzhang warned.
"Yes, Your Excellency!" They all understood this.
After receiving the telegram from Li Jingfang, Li Jingyuan, who was far away in Europe, understood the concerns at home and immediately replied that he would make preparations.
The current situation in China is that the Westernization faction fears the conservative faction, while the conservative faction fears the foreign masters.
Therefore, hiring foreigners to manage those projects should save a lot of trouble.
This can be considered as learning from the barbarians to control them!
Li Jingyuan registered a company called Far East Development Company in the German Empire, which was responsible for the construction of the factory on the Liaodong Peninsula.
The head of the Far East Development Company will be German.
With the Far East Development Company as the main entity, it invested in the construction of steel plants, arsenals, shipyards, and railways, etc.
In that case, even if the Qing government wanted to strangle them, they would have to see if they had the guts to oppose the foreigners.
Judging from those guys' behavior, they wouldn't dare offend the foreigners at all.
At the Vulcan shipyard, the design of the new cruiser was quickly completed according to Li Jingyuan's requirements.
Rudolf Hacker, the chief engineer and technical director of the Vulcan shipyard, even traveled to Hamburg in person to negotiate the order with Li Jingyuan.
"Mr. Li, I really don't understand why you chose Krupp to build the shipyard instead of us?"
The Vulcan shipyard was the largest and most technologically advanced shipyard in the German Empire. Even in the whole of Europe, it was one of the top shipyards.
We are fully capable of building you a truly modern, large-scale shipyard.
Rudolf Hacker looked like a resentful woman who had been abandoned.
Despite the fact that the Vulcan shipyard has received many orders from the Navy in recent years.
However, a large, modern shipyard would cost at least 20 million marks.
If the Vulcan shipyard can secure this order, it will be able to reap considerable profits.
"Your Excellency, I apologize; this was my oversight. However, I have already signed a contract with Krupp. I'm afraid it cannot be changed now."
Of course, there are still many opportunities for us to cooperate.
"Once this batch of warships is completed, I will place even more orders!"
Li Jingyuan said.
In Li Jingyuan's view, most of the warships of the Beiyang Fleet, except for a few, were of little use.
Therefore, once he takes command of the Beiyang Fleet, he will inevitably have to build even more warships on a large scale.
Before they have the capacity to build it themselves, purchasing it from outside becomes the only option.
Rudolf Hacker nodded, though with some regret.
However, if we can get more orders from Li Jingyuan, then it won't be a loss.
"Mr. Li, these are the design drawings we have completed." Rudolf Hacker took out several design drawings from his briefcase.
Li Jingyuan examined it carefully.
According to the specifications marked on the design drawings, this cruiser had a displacement of 12 tons, a maximum speed of 25 knots, and was equipped with three triple 155mm rapid-fire guns (45 caliber), six twin 120mm rapid-fire guns (45 caliber), four 88mm rapid-fire guns (45 caliber), twelve 47mm rapid-fire guns, and two 37mm rapid-fire guns. It also featured two triple 356mm torpedo tubes.
The thickness of the main armor, including the waterline armor, main gun turret armor, and conning tower armor, all reached 100 mm.
Li Jingyuan was very satisfied with the performance of this warship.
At least when compared to the Japanese destroyer Yoshino, it had an overwhelming advantage in terms of firepower, defense, and speed.
Especially considering that the Japanese had only one protected cruiser, the Yoshino.
If the Beiyang Fleet were to equip itself with a few more new cruisers, it would be able to completely crush the Japanese in future naval battles.
"Your Excellency, this is indeed a very good warship, I am very satisfied!" Li Jingyuan made no attempt to hide his satisfaction.
He had already decided to name the warship the "Sea and Sky" class cruiser.
The exact number to be built will depend on the price.
If the price satisfies him and the cost-effectiveness is high, ordering several more is not out of the question.
Rudolf Hacker's face immediately lit up with a smile.
Li Jingyuan's attitude suggests that the likelihood of this deal succeeding is very high.
Next, it depends on how much the two sides can negotiate on the price.
For the Vulcan shipyard, this is simply a matter of high or low profits.
